On April 6, 2021, Gene Youngblood has died. I had the honour to edit with Simonetta Fadda the Italian edition of his seminal essay Expanded Cinema in a book series coproduced by Noema. In 2020 he sent me the "Introduction to the Fiftieth Anniversary Edition of Expanded Cinema" in order to publish it in Noema. It was a honour for us, as well as it is a honour now to celebrate Gene Youngblood's fundamental work proposing that essay again. Pier Luigi Capucci, Noema President

In scholarship the Anthropocene has been tied up with the experience of the unthinkable by thinkers including Timothy Morton, Donna Haraway, and Amitav Ghosh. Yet, the current COVID-19 pandemic—which as a crisis also exemplifies the human impact on and a reshaping of environments—challenges the pervasiveness of the key concepts of abstraction and unthinkability. Instead, the pandemic has turned the Anthropocene into a concrete, intensely lived, globally shared experience.

The Anthropocene imposes a reflection about the time span of the human species and cultures in contrast to that of the individuals, requires a vision extended to a remote future that should be governed knowing that people will not be part of it. This implies a cognitive leap, a different consideration of humanity and its relationship with the “non human” and the environment, intended as a complex dynamic intercourse, towards a further level of awareness in a new pact with the existing. xCoAx is an exploration of the intersection where computational tools and media meet art and culture, in the form of a multi-disciplinary enquiry on aesthetics, computation, communication and the elusive X factor that connects them all. The focus of xCoAx is on the unpredictable overlaps between the freedom of creativity and the rules of algorithms, between human nature and machine technology, with the aim to evolve towards new directions in aesthetics.
Eduardo Kac has raised many nodal questions on the transformations of society and culture, in a constant creative relationship with the technology and the science of his time. In his research communication, intended as mutual information exchange is a fundamental topic. This makes Kac a perfect interpreter of the resources and contradictions of the contemporary, with a strong vision on how the present time can possibly develop and evolve into the future.

Since 2010 the Bioart Society is organizing the ARS BIOARCTICA RESIDENCY PROGRAMME together with the Kilpisjärvi Biological Station of the University of Helsinki in the sub-Arctic Lapland in the traditional Sami lands. The residency has an emphasis on the subarctic environment and art and science collaboration.
